THE ROLE:

We are seeking a dynamic and results-driven Business Development Lead/Sales Person to join our team at McKenzie. As a key member of our business development team, you will play a crucial role in driving sales growth, expanding our client base, and increasing revenue opportunities.

RESPONSIBILITIES:

  • Develop and implement strategic sales plans to achieve company objectives and revenue targets.
  • Identify and cultivate new business opportunities through proactive prospecting, networking, and relationship-building efforts.
  • Conduct market research and competitive analysis to identify emerging trends, industry opportunities, and potential clients.
  • Collaborate with the marketing team to develop compelling sales collateral, presentations, and proposals that showcase our company's capabilities and value proposition.
  • Build and maintain strong relationships with key stakeholders, including architects, developers, property owners, and other industry professionals.
  • Lead the entire sales process from initial contact through contract negotiation, closing, and project kickoff.
  • Collaborate with project management and operations teams to ensure seamless transition and delivery of projects to clients.
  • Track sales metrics, analyze performance data, and generate regular reports to monitor progress against sales targets and identify areas for improvement.
  • Represent the company at industry events, trade shows, and networking functions to promote brand awareness and generate leads.
